Parenting can be very challenging while truly rewarding work. It is nonetheless difficult when we feel overwhelmed by our child, uncertain about how to parent a difficult child, or unfulfilled in the role as mother or father. These feelings can be even more pronounced when parenting a child with special needs.
Some of the issues I help parents with are
- Helping parents feel more able to reason through parenting challenges to find appropriate responses
- Helping parents feel more confident in their role
- Teaching parents how to create appropriate limits and how to tolerate experiencing your child's psychological discomfort when they bump up against a limit.
- Teaching parents how to rear self-confident children
- Helping couples be more united in their approach to parenting
- Helping parents of special needs children cope with the unique challenges associated with raising these special kids.
